免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ios的逆向签名方法

iOS逆向签名是指通过一些技术手段,将已经打包好的iOS应用进行反向操作,使其能够在未经过苹果官方认证的设备上运行。这种方法对于开发者来说,可以在未经过App Store审核的情况下,将应用分发给用户。而对于黑客来说,这种方法则可以用来破解应用程序,进行非法活动。下面我们来详细介绍一下iOS逆向签名的方法和原理。

1. 原理

在iOS系统中,每个应用都有一个特定的开发者证书,这个证书包含了应用程序的签名。当我们下载应用程序时,系统会验证这个签名是否与苹果官方的证书相匹配,如果匹配,就可以安装和运行应用程序。而在逆向签名过程中,我们需要使用一些工具来修改应用程序的签名,使其能够在未经过苹果官方认证的设备上运行。

2. 方法

iOS逆向签名的方法有很多种,这里我们介绍两种比较常用的方法:重签名和越狱签名。

2.1 重签名

重签名是指使用开发者自己的证书来对已经打包好的应用程序进行重新签名,以达到绕过苹果官方认证的目的。具体步骤如下:

1) 下载需要重签名的应用程序,解压后找到Payload文件夹。

2) 将Payload文件夹中的应用程序复制到桌面上,并用一个新的Bundle ID来重新命名。

3) 使用Xcode创建一个新的iOS应用程序项目,将新的Bundle ID设置为与上一步中重命名的应用程序相同。

4) 在开发者中心申请一个新的证书,并使用这个证书来对新的应用程序进行签名。

5) 将签名后的新应用程序拖到桌面上,并将其复制到原来的Payload文件夹中,替换原来的应用程序。

6) 使用越狱设备或者越狱模拟器运行重签名后的应用程序。

2.2 越狱签名

越狱签名是指在越狱设备上使用非官方的工具来对应用程序进行签名,以达到绕过苹果官方认证的目的。具体步骤如下:

1) 在越狱设备上安装AppSync插件,这个插件可以让设备安装未签名的应用程序。

2) 下载需要逆向签名的应用程序,使用iTools等工具将应用程序拷贝到越狱设备上。

3) 使用非官方的签名工具对应用程序进行签名,生成一个新的ipa文件。

4) 将签名后的ipa文件使用iTools等工具拷贝到越狱设备上,并安装。

5) 在越狱设备上运行签名后的应用程序。

3. 总结

iOS逆向签名是一种绕过苹果官方认证的方法,可以用来分发未经过App Store审核的应用程序或者进行非法活动。在使用这种方法时,需要注意遵守相关法律法规,不得进行违法活动。


相关知识:
苹果证书永不过期怎么办
苹果证书是开发者在苹果官方网站上获取的一种数字证书,用于在苹果设备上安装和运行应用程序。由于苹果证书的有效期限只有一年,因此开发者需要在证书过期前更新证书以继续使用应用程序。然而,有些开发者声称他们的苹果证书永不过期,这是如何实现的呢?首先,需要了解苹果证
2023-04-07
苹果签名版
苹果签名版是苹果公司为了保证用户安全和防止盗版而推出的一项技术。它的原理是使用数字签名来验证软件的真实性和完整性,确保用户安全下载和使用软件。数字签名是一种用于验证文件真实性和完整性的技术,它通过使用公钥加密和私钥解密的方式来保证文件的安全性。数字签名可以
2023-04-07
苹果签名客服
苹果签名客服是一种服务,主要是为了解决用户在使用苹果设备时遇到的签名问题。在苹果设备上,签名是一种数字证书,用于验证应用程序的身份和完整性。但是,由于各种原因,签名可能会过期、失效、被撤销或被拒绝,这会影响用户的使用体验。苹果签名客服就是为了解决这些问题而
2023-04-07
苹果无线网连接证书不通过
苹果无线网连接证书不通过是指在使用iPhone、iPad等苹果设备连接无线网络时,出现证书验证不通过的情况。这种情况可能会导致无法连接网络,给用户带来不便。这种情况的原因通常是由于无线网络使用了自签名证书,而苹果设备默认不信任自签名证书,因此会提示证书验证
2023-04-07
ios重签名手机操作步骤
iOS重签名是指将已经存在的iOS应用程序进行重新签名,以便能够在其他设备上安装和运行。这个过程需要使用到Xcode和iOS App Signer工具,下面将为大家详细介绍iOS重签名的手机操作步骤。一、准备工作1.下载并安装Xcode开发工具,打开Xco
2023-04-07
ios都有什么证书
iOS证书是用于证明应用程序或服务的身份和安全性的数字证书。它们由苹果公司颁发,用于保护iOS应用程序和服务的完整性和安全性。在iOS开发中,有多种类型的证书可用。下面将详细介绍每种证书的原理和用途。1. 开发者证书开发者证书是用于开发和测试iOS应用程序
2023-04-07
ios怎么用电脑签名
在iOS设备上,由于系统限制,只有来自苹果官方App Store的应用才能在设备上运行。但是,有时我们需要在设备上运行一些第三方应用,而这些应用可能并没有在App Store上架。这时,我们就需要用到签名工具,将应用签名后安装到设备上。本文将介绍如何使用电
2023-04-07
ios开发者证书与profile
iOS开发者证书与Profile是iOS开发中必不可少的两个组成部分。开发者证书是由Apple颁发的一种数字证书,用于验证iOS应用程序的开发者身份,而Profile则是一种配置文件,用于将开发者证书与应用程序绑定,以便在开发和测试应用程序时使用。一、iO
2023-04-07
ios应用重签名
iOS应用重签名是指将一个已经存在的iOS应用在不修改应用内容的情况下,重新签名成另一个开发者或企业的应用,使得该应用可以在其他设备上安装和运行。这在开发者或企业需要将应用分发给不同的用户时非常有用,因为可以避免每个用户都需要通过App Store下载应用
2023-04-07
iosapp掉签名
iOS应用程序掉签名指的是在使用iOS设备的过程中,应用程序在运行时被系统强制关闭。这种情况通常发生在使用未经过官方认证的应用程序时。iOS应用程序的签名是指苹果公司在应用程序发布前对应用程序进行的一种认证机制,目的是确保应用程序的来源和安全性。应用程序掉
2023-04-07
ios15签名文件
iOS 15 是苹果公司最新的移动操作系统,它带来了许多新功能和改进。在使用 iOS 15 的过程中,我们可能需要安装一些未经 App Store 审核的应用程序。但是,由于苹果公司的限制,iOS 设备只能安装经过签名的应用程序。因此,我们需要了解 iOS
2023-04-07
ios 推送证书过期了
iOS 推送证书是开发者将 App 推送到用户设备上时所必需的一个凭证。当开发者需要将 App 推送到用户设备上时,需要在 Apple 开发者网站上创建一个推送证书,然后将该证书与 App Bundle ID 关联,最后将证书下载下来并在服务器端使用。推送
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4